|  | Regular Member | Join Date: Aug-03 Location: Cleveland, near Brisvegas Age: 27 | | | | My female is gravid at the moment and should lay in the next couple of days. I have a 10L tub 2/3 filled with soil/sand and peat mixture. When you buy it make sure it has no fertilisers in it!! You could use a cat litter tray if you want. Make sure the soil is warm and damp to!! She dug herself a nice big hole today so it wont be too long!!

|  | Regular Member | Join Date: Jan-03 Location: Melbourne O>I>G>L Souly! | | | | When my Beardie layed her eggs I had over 300mm of potting mix banked up one end of the enclosure and she dug a tunnel right to the base of the enclosure, turned right and then layed! The tunnel would have been close to two foot long! |  | |
